About Oscar
-Having completed year 12 in 2021 at Prince Alfred college in Adelaide, South Australia I have continued to follow my interests in maths, physics and economics at the university level, studying mechanical engineering and finance & banking.
- In year 12 I studied economics, physics, PE and the 2 highest levels of mathematics available in the SACE; namely, specialist mathematics and mathematical methods. Graduating with an ATAR of 93.8.
-I am currently halfway through my third year in a double degree at the UofA in
mechanical engineering (honours) and finance & banking. I have continued to build on my strong background in maths and economics through this degree, completing 4 mathematics course and several economics course at the distinction level.
-My professional interests currently lie in medical device engineering and I commence a summer internship at Austofix over the summer.

-My approach to math and economics tutoring sessions is simple, effective and ensures the key concepts stick for my students.
-I try my best to instil in students the required knowledge and skills to tackle difficult concepts the first time around, but also to be able to revisit the concepts I have taught with a sense of clarity and confidence they have learnt them thoroughly.
-Having tutored across a range of ages from years 7-12, I feel the most successful approach is to allow for students to drive the initial areas/concepts they are struggling with and then to unpack these together via explanation and then examples for active reinforcement. I like to end my sessions with a short recap of the concepts that have been tackled to ensure concepts are now clear to the student, making it easy to revisit the concepts before your tests/exams.
